
“I’ve already cited the case of a North Carolina doctor who decided to use market-based pricing, and I’ve shared a very powerful video from Reason TV about a hospital in Oklahoma that’s doing the same thing. Now we have a free market revolution by a doctor in Maine: Dr. Michael Ciampi took a step this spring that many of his fellow physicians would describe as radical. The family physician stopped accepting all forms of health insurance. In early 2013, Ciampi sent a letter to his patients informing them that he would no longer accept any kind of health coverage, both private and government-sponsored. He posted his prices on the practice’s website.”
